Programmierung

908
Shell-Befehl ausführen und Ausgabe ausgeben

Ich möchte eine Funktion schreiben, die einen Shell-Befehl ausführt und seine Ausgabe als Zeichenfolge zurückgibt , unabhängig davon, ob es sich um eine Fehler- oder Erfolgsmeldung handelt. Ich möchte nur das gleiche Ergebnis erzielen, das ich mit der Befehlszeile erzielt hätte. Was wäre ein...

906
Was sind "benannte Tupel" in Python?

Beim Lesen der Änderungen in Python 3.1 fand ich etwas ... Unerwartetes: Das Tupel sys.version_info ist jetzt ein benanntes Tupel : Ich habe noch nie von benannten Tupeln gehört und dachte, Elemente könnten entweder durch Zahlen (wie in Tupeln und Listen) oder durch Schlüssel (wie in Diktaten)...

904
Überprüfen Sie, ob eine Variable vom Funktionstyp ist

Angenommen, ich habe eine Variable, die wie folgt definiert ist: var a = function() {/* Statements */}; Ich möchte eine Funktion, die prüft, ob der Typ der Variablen funktionsähnlich ist. dh: function foo(v) {if (v is function type?) {/* do something */}}; foo(a); Wie kann ich auf die oben...

903
Richtige Verwendung von 'Yield Return'

Overа этот вопрос есть ответы на Stapelüberlauf на русском : В чем польза Ausbeute? Das Yield- Schlüsselwort ist eines dieser Schlüsselwörter in C #, das mich immer wieder mystifiziert, und ich war mir nie sicher, ob ich es richtig verwende. Welcher der beiden folgenden Codeteile ist der...

903
Berechnen Sie den Fingerabdruck des RSA-Schlüssels

Ich muss die SSH-Schlüsselprüfung für GitHub durchführen, bin mir jedoch nicht sicher, wie ich meinen RSA-Schlüsselfingerabdruck finde. Ich habe ursprünglich eine Anleitung zum Generieren eines SSH-Schlüssels unter Linux befolgt. Welchen Befehl muss ich eingeben, um meinen aktuellen Fingerabdruck...

902
differenziere null = True, blank = True in Django

Möchten Sie diesen Beitrag verbessern? Geben Sie detaillierte Antworten auf diese Frage, einschließlich Zitaten und einer Erklärung, warum Ihre Antwort richtig ist. Antworten ohne ausreichende Details können bearbeitet oder gelöscht werden. Wenn wir ein Datenbankfeld in Django hinzufügen,...

900
So iterieren Sie über Argumente in einem Bash-Skript

Ich habe einen komplexen Befehl, aus dem ich ein Shell / Bash-Skript erstellen möchte. Ich kann es in Bezug auf $1leicht schreiben : foo $1 args -o $1.ext Ich möchte in der Lage sein, mehrere Eingabenamen an das Skript zu übergeben. Was ist der richtige Weg, um es zu tun? Und natürlich möchte...

900
Wie erhalte ich die Größe der Tabellen einer MySQL-Datenbank?

Ich kann diese Abfrage ausführen, um die Größe aller Tabellen in einer MySQL-Datenbank zu ermitteln: show table status from myDatabaseName; Ich hätte gerne Hilfe beim Verständnis der Ergebnisse. Ich suche Tische mit den größten Größen. Welche Spalte soll ich mir

899
Was bedeutet "POSIX"?

Was ist POSIX? Ich habe den Wikipedia-Artikel gelesen und lese ihn jedes Mal, wenn ich auf den Begriff stoße. Tatsache ist, dass ich nie wirklich verstanden habe, was es ist. Kann mir jemand das bitte erklären, indem er auch "die Notwendigkeit von POSIX"